Just in case you need a boat to follow in this year's Sydney to Hobart, my husband is competing yet again on a boat owned by Paul Clitheroe called Balance. It's a newly acquired boat ( a TP52 ) and is a big step up from the 45 ft Benneteau that they used to go to Hobart on. The TP52 is all business......a full on racing machine built for speed. No luxuries that they have become used to on the old Benneteau like my Beef in Red Wine with Mash or my home made Chrissy cake!! It's all freeze dried food and no toilet on board (toilet weighs too much!!)They should arrive at Constitution Dock at least a full day earlier than in previous years. They are tipped to have a really good chance at coming in the top finishers in their division. Should be a great race as weather conditions at the moment are favouring the 50-60 footers but that can change at a moments notice!!
